Default Question for the Australians here

I have some plastic that I am painting, I have seen a product called Bulldog adhesion promoter that the guys in the states use. Is there a similar product here in Australia?

Sorry for the delay - you have probably already found what you need... I always use Flexi Primer - readily available and comes in rattle can I think "Autospray" make it. great reliable product.

I use the Septone one a fair bit, I also use their adhesion promoter, it's clear and you only need to mist it on, works a treat.
